About Erik Wallstroem

Erik Wallstroem is a scholar working on Pathology and Forensic Medicine, Neurology, Molecular Biology, Pulmonary and Respiratory Medicine and Immunology, having authored 20 papers that have together received 1.1k indexed citations. Recurring topics across this work include Peripheral Neuropathies and Disorders (5 papers), Multiple Sclerosis Research Studies (5 papers), Myasthenia Gravis and Thymoma (2 papers), Hereditary Neurological Disorders (2 papers), Coagulation, Bradykinin, Polyphosphates, and Angioedema (2 papers), Immunotherapy and Immune Responses (2 papers), Lung Cancer Treatments and Mutations (2 papers) and Polyomavirus and related diseases (1 paper). The work is most often cited by research in Developmental Neuroscience (229 citations), Pathology and Forensic Medicine (612 citations), Neurology (253 citations), Neurology (185 citations) and Immunology (265 citations). Erik Wallstroem has collaborated with scholars based in United States, Switzerland and France. Frequent co-authors include Andreas Stefferl, Maria K. Storch, Barbara Kornek, Tomas Olsson, Manfred Schmidbauer, Robert Weissert, Hans Lassmann, Christopher Linington, Anna N. Belova and Donald R. Johns. Their work appears in journals such as Neurology, Multiple Sclerosis and Related Disorders, New England Journal of Medicine, Journal of the Peripheral Nervous System and Journal of Neurology.
